is a mountain in , South Korea. Its area extends across the cities of and . It has an elevation of 587 m. The mountain is home to two Buddhist shrines commemorating Silla priests Wonhyo and Uisang, and a small temple called Jajaeam. is situated 4 km southeast of Yangwŏl-li.

station is an elevated metro station on Line 1 of the Seoul Subway in Yeoncheon, South Korea. The station was first opened as Choseong-ri station on Gyeongwon Line on December 30, 1951. is situated 3½ km northeast of Yangwŏl-li.
